    The root mean square velocity of an ideal gas in a closed container of fixed volume is increased from \[5\times {{10}^{4}}\,cm\,{{s}^{-1}}\] to \[10\times {{10}^{4}}\,cm\,{{s}^{-1}}\]. Which of the following statement correctly explains how the change is accomplished [Pb. CET 1986]

    A)                 By heating the gas, the temperature is doubled

    B)                 By heating the gas, the pressure is quadrupled (i.e. made four times)

    C)                 By heating the gas, the temperature is quadrupled

    D)                 By heating the gas, the pressure is doubled

    Correct Answer: B

    Solution :

                    \[\frac{{{U}_{1}}}{{{U}_{2}}}=\sqrt{\frac{{{T}_{1}}}{{{T}_{2}}}}\] \[\therefore \frac{{{T}_{1}}}{{{T}_{2}}}={{\left( \frac{5\times {{10}^{4}}}{10\times {{10}^{4}}} \right)}^{2}}=\frac{1}{4}\]
